What Are the Benefits of Using a VPN for Streaming?
- Access to Geo-Restricted Content: Many broadcasters limit their streams based on location. A VPN allows you to connect to servers in different countries, bypassing these restrictions.
- Improved Security: Using a VPN encrypts your internet connection, protecting your data from potential snoopers, especially on public Wi-Fi networks.
- Cost-Effective: With services available for as little as $2.50 per month, a VPN offers an affordable way to enjoy live sports without breaking the bank.
Limitations and Considerations
While using a VPN has many benefits, there are limitations to consider:
- Speed Issues: Streaming through a VPN may result in slower internet speeds due to encryption and server location.
- Legal Considerations: Always check the legality of using a VPN for streaming in your country, as some regions have specific regulations against it.
- Quality of Service: Not all VPNs are created equal; it's essential to choose one that offers fast speeds and reliable connections for streaming.
